SKYRARS DARK WOLVES

 

The Dark Wolves are a recently formed warband that now threatens the Fenris Sector

 

ORIGINS

 

Skyrar’s Dark Wolves are a recently organized renegade warband centered around the previous 8th Great Company before Sven Bloodhowl was elevated to the rank of Wolf Lord. The Great Company had been declared excommicates be the Ordo Hereticus in response to a inncendet whitch saw the Space Wolves 5th Great Company devastated. Though the 8th company pleaded innocence the Ordo would not back down, despite the protests of the Great Wolf Logan Grimnar, due to lack of factual evidence. The company , at the time around 250 marines, was pursed into the Maelstrom and not heard from sense. Recently the Renegades were discovered in the Fenris Sector accompanied by elements of the World Eaters Legion and the Renegade Warband, The Flawless Host. The Ordo Herecticus engaged with a Large IG contingent lead by the Order of our Martyred Lady. The battle, mainly occurring in space, was lost due to several boarding actions in which the Sisters and imperial Guard forces were poorly suited. During the engagement the Dark Wolves were discovered to be obedient to a previous unheard of lesser Chaos Power called Skyrar, of what we known the chaos power reveals itself as a goddess of hospitality, and seems to attract those looking for sanctuary from the Imperium and forging new bonds of brotherhood that they are unable to find elsewhere. While not near as powerful as the 4 Dark Powers, Skyrar is rising in influence as many pirates and excommunicated forces are fleeing from persecution to her protection.

 

ORGANIZATION

 

The Warband in found to be exclusive to only renegades of the Space Wolves chapter. Of witch the warbands size is climbing alarmingly as previous traitors from that chapter are flocking to its banner, eager to reclaim the lost bonds of brotherhood only ones of Russes Gene seed can understand. Little else is known besides this, other than that the warbands within the Dark Wolves often retain the titles they held in the Space Wolves chapter such as Wolf Lord and Wolf Guard. Veterans of the Warbands commonly designate themselves by ritually scarring themselves across their left eye, a mark they also make on their helmets.

 

HOMEWORLD

 

The Dark Wolves function from their Battle Barge the Wolf’s Vengence, they refuse to call anywhere home but Fenris, and seek to reclaim it as their own.

 

COMBAT DORCTRINES

 

The Warbands seem to retain their previous tactics they used before their fall, though they now act less like a well organized wolf pack and more like starved, desperate, ravaged wolfs backed into a corner. They prefer Close Combat but not to the extent that they will sacrifice heavy weapons and vehicles.

 

GENESEED

 

The Geneseed of the Dark Wolves is exclusively from the Space Wolves Stock. Renegade marines from other chapters are not accepted.

 

BELIEFS

 

The Dark Wolves view the Imperium as corrupted and the Space Wolves as Oathbreakers. They view chaos as a force that can be beneficial is used correctly, a such they will make deals and packs with daemons but will never sell their souls to them as they belong only to Skyrar. The Dark Wolves seek to free the Imperium from their corrupt High Lords, starting with Fenris.

 

BATTLECRY

 

BY MY FANG AND CLAW! THE GODDESS WILL ARISE!
